Concrete Pipe Bottom Ring Manufacturing Facilities Overview

The Role of SRC Concrete Pipe Bottom Ring Factories in Infrastructure Development


In modern infrastructure projects, concrete pipes serve as essential components for various applications, including drainage systems, wastewater management, and stormwater management. Among these, SRC (Steel Reinforced Concrete) pipe bottom rings are critical for enhancing the strength and durability of concrete pipes. This article explores the importance of SRC concrete pipe bottom ring factories, their manufacturing processes, and their contributions to infrastructure development.


Understanding SRC Concrete Pipe Bottom Rings


SRC concrete pipe bottom rings are specialized components designed to provide structural integrity to concrete pipes. These rings are typically made from a combination of high-quality concrete and steel reinforcement, which together offer enhanced tensile strength and resistance to external forces. The incorporation of steel bars or mesh within the concrete matrix allows these pipes to withstand various stressors, including soil pressure, traffic loads, and environmental conditions.


The Manufacturing Process of SRC Bottom Rings


The manufacturing of SRC concrete pipe bottom rings involves several critical steps, each designed to ensure that the final product meets stringent quality standards.


1. Material Selection The process begins with selecting high-quality raw materials, including Portland cement, coarse and fine aggregates, water, and steel reinforcement. These materials must be sourced from reliable suppliers to ensure consistency and performance.


2. Mixing The concrete mix is prepared in large batches, ensuring that the correct proportions of ingredients are used. This thorough mixing process is crucial for achieving the desired workability and strength of the concrete.


3. Molding Once the concrete mix is ready, it is poured into specially designed molds that shape the bottom rings. These molds are typically constructed from durable materials that can withstand the weight and pressure of the concrete.


4. Curing After the molds are filled, the concrete needs to cure to achieve maximum strength. Curing is a critical phase that involves maintaining optimal moisture levels and temperature for a specific duration, allowing the chemical reactions within the concrete to occur effectively.

5. Quality Control Finally, each batch of SRC concrete pipe bottom rings undergoes rigorous quality control testing. This includes checking for dimensional accuracy, strength testing, and ensuring compliance with industry standards. Only products that pass these tests are approved for delivery to clients.


The Importance of SRC Concrete Pipe Bottom Ring Factories


SRC concrete pipe bottom ring factories play a pivotal role in the construction industry. Their contributions can be summarized as follows


1. Enhanced Durability The use of steel reinforcement in concrete significantly increases the strength and longevity of the pipes. This durability is crucial in ensuring that infrastructure projects remain functional and safe for extended periods, reducing the need for frequent repairs or replacements.


2. Design Versatility SRC concrete pipes are available in various sizes and shapes, allowing for flexibility in design. This versatility makes them suitable for a wide range of applications, from residential drainage systems to large-scale municipal projects.
